Two Poems by JoyAnne O'Donnell

 






Autumns Whistles


Autumn blows 
red leaves a show
a great ancient wind
that glows with candles fire
dripping with hot life
inside to outside rays of coloured glory
blowing great autumn thistle
autumn's beautiful whistle.



Piano of Peace


The strong white piano keys
open peaceful clouds light 
In spirits home sight 
playing peace music notes
promotes hope with sweet music
from the evenings song
with candlelight on top of the piano
creating ambiance 
joyous charms radiance.








JoyAnne O'Donnell is a poet from Pennsylvania, she loves to take walks by a golden pond frequently to write and muse. Her five poetry books are on amazon. Two time Pushcart nominee.
